Transaction 843ddc10c305ebc476adf8dd39fc6234a1d097f7a5b2b2841f59754eec061ff3
1 Input
1 Output
-
843ddc10c305ebc476adf8dd39fc6234a1d097f7a5b2b2841f59754eec061ff3:0
- value
- 32172499
- script pubkey
- OP_0 OP_PUSHBYTES_20 103e6105ac0005a99d386bf9584a1543f115ecf3
- address
- bc1qzqlxzpdvqqz6n8fcd0u4sjs4g0c3tm8n3897f3